Dental Sealers
Dental sealers are a valuable protective action in pediatric dental care, designed to shield children's teeth from decay. These slim, plastic coverings are related to the chewing surface areas of molars and premolars, where dental caries usually establish as a result of the deep grooves and pits that can trap food bits and bacteria. By completing these susceptible areas, sealers develop a smooth surface area that is much easier to cleanse and less most likely to nurture dangerous substances.
The application of dental sealers is a pain-free and quick procedure. The dental professional starts by cleaning the tooth surface area, complied with by the application of an unique gel that helps the sealer adhere successfully. Once the sealant is put, it is solidified utilizing a healing light, giving immediate security.
Research study suggests that sealers can decrease the danger of cavities by approximately 80% in kids. They are particularly advised for children that go to greater threat of oral degeneration, making them a crucial part of preventive oral treatment. Routine oral examinations will make certain that sealers remain efficient and undamaged, adding to a kid's total oral health and well-being.
Fluoride Therapies
Fluoride treatments play a substantial function in boosting youngsters's dental health, enhancing safety steps such as oral sealants. These therapies include the application of fluoride, a naturally happening mineral, to the teeth, which aids to reinforce enamel and avoid degeneration. Pediatric dental practitioners normally recommend fluoride therapies during regular examinations, specifically for children at greater threat of tooth cavities.
The application process is pain-free and quick, usually involving a gel, foam, or varnish that is positioned on the teeth for a short duration. The fluoride works by remineralizing cheap dental care areas of the enamel that may have started to degeneration, efficiently reversing early-stage cavities. Furthermore, fluoride assists to inhibit the growth of damaging bacteria in the mouth, more reducing the probability of dental caries.
Pediatric dental practitioners analyze each youngster's individual needs, considering their diet, oral hygiene techniques, and general health. kids dentist. It is essential for moms and dads to understand that while fluoride treatments are beneficial, they ought to be utilized in conjunction with proper oral treatment techniques, consisting of regular cleaning, flossing, and routine dental brows through. By including fluoride therapies right into a detailed oral health method, children can enjoy healthier teeth and a lower risk of cavities
Actions Management Strategies
When dealing with the unique needs of young patients, pediatric dental experts commonly use actions monitoring methods to develop a favorable and calming setting. These methods are important for minimizing anxiousness and cultivating participation throughout dental gos to.
One typically made use of technique is positive reinforcement, where dentists applaud youngsters for their etiquette, consequently motivating them to duplicate such activities in the future. An additional approach is using tell-show-do, where the dental practitioner describes a procedure using simple language, shows it on a model or non-living object, and after that performs it on the youngster, making the experience much less daunting.
Disturbance techniques, such as providing playthings, videos, or digital devices, can properly draw away a kid's attention from the oral treatment, decreasing worry and discomfort. For some children, specifically those with heightened her explanation anxiousness or unique demands, an extra structured technique might be needed. In these cases, sedation dental care can be thought about, permitting a calmer experience while guaranteeing safety and comfort.
Integrating these actions management strategies not just helps pediatric dental professionals attain effective outcomes yet likewise instills a favorable attitude towards oral care that can last a life time.
